    extreme hesitation

    Do you have a humming sound coming from the transmission tunnel? It won't consistently be there, but it'll definitely come and go. It sort of sounds like the fuel pump. Just in the front of the car. If this is the case, your transmission pump is on its way out. This is what's wrong with my...
